Sarah Wendlandt is a scholar working on Infectious Diseases, Molecular Biology and Clinical Biochem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Sarah Wendlandt has authored 21 papers receiving a total of 787 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 19 papers in Infectious Diseases, 12 papers in Molecular Biology and 6 papers in Clinical Biochemistry. Recurrent topics in Sarah Wendlandt’s work include Antimicrobial Resistance in Staphylococcus (19 papers), Bacterial biofilms and quorum sensing (12 papers) and Bacterial Identification and Susceptibility Testing (6 papers). Sarah Wendlandt is often cited by papers focused on Antimicrobial Resistance in Staphylococcus (19 papers), Bacterial biofilms and quorum sensing (12 papers) and Bacterial Identification and Susceptibility Testing (6 papers). Sarah Wendlandt collaborates with scholars based in Germany, China and The Netherlands. Sarah Wendlandt's co-authors include Štefan Schwarz, Kristina Kadlec, Andrea T. Feßler, Stefan Monecke, Ralf Ehricht, P. Silley, Yang Wang, Congming Wu, Jianzhong Shen and Beibei Li and has published in prestigious journals such as Antimicrobial Agents and Chemotherapy, Trends in Microbiology and Journal of Antimicrobial Chemotherapy.
